The W is the third album by the American hip hop group Wu-Tang Clan, released on November 21, 2000. Singles from this album included "Protect Ya Neck (The Jump Off)", "Gravel Pit", "I Can't Go To Sleep", and the banned from TV "Careful (Click, Click)". The album was certified Platinum in the U.S., and gold in Canada.

Wu-Tang Clan is a hip-hop group that consists of: RZA, GZA/Genius, Ghostface Killah, Raekwon, Ol' Dirty Bastard, Method Man, Inspectah Deck, U-God, and Masta Killa. They are frequently joined by fellow childhood friend Cappadonna, a quasi member of the group. They were formed in (and are associated with) the New York City borough of Staten Island (referred to by members as "Shaolin"), though Masta Killa and GZA are from Brooklyn and Inspectah Deck is from the Bronx.
